Lightning vs. Panthers NHL Predictions, Picks and Odds - Feb. 5

05 February 2026 By Data Skrive

The Tampa Bay Lightning (36-14-4) host the Florida Panthers (29-24-3) on Thursday, Feb. 5, with both teams coming off a victory. The oddsmakers have made the Lightning solid favorites at -185 on the moneyline, and the Panthers are at +154.

Tampa Bay grabbed a 4-3 victory at home its last time out on Feb. 3 against the Buffalo Sabres. Nikita Kucherov's four points (one goal and three assists) led the Lightning.

Florida got a 5-4 home victory over the Boston Bruins on Feb. 4 in its last game, winning the shootout 2-1. Anton Lundell's three points (one goal and two assists) in that matchup led the Panthers.

Lightning Key Stats

  • Tampa Bay's 189 total goals (3.5 per game) make it the eighth-highest scoring team in the NHL.
  • Defensively, the Lightning have been one of the stingiest squads in NHL action, conceding 137 total goals (2.5 per game) to rank second.
  • Its +52 goal differential is the second-best in the league.
  • The 37 power-play goals the Lightning have put up this season rank 13th in the NHL (on 170 power-play chances).
  • Tampa Bay's 21.76% power-play conversion rate ranks 14th in the league.
  • The three shorthanded goals the Lightning have scored this season rank 20th among NHL teams.
  • Tampa Bay has the league's fourth-best penalty-kill percentage (83.93%).
  • Tampa Bay has the 29th-ranked faceoff win percentage in the NHL, at 47%.
  • The Lightning make 12.5% of their shots (third in the league).

Panthers Key Stats

  • Florida's 169 goals on the season (3.0 per game) rank 19th in the NHL.
  • The Panthers have allowed 184 total goals this season (3.3 per game), 25th in the league.
  • With a goal differential of -15, the team is 23rd in the league.
  • The Panthers have 39 power-play goals (on 204 chances), eighth in the NHL.
  • Florida's power-play percentage (19.12) ranks the team 20th in the league.
  • This season, the Panthers have six shorthanded goals (seventh in league).
  • At 82.74%, Florida has the sixth-best penalty-kill percentage in the league.
  • Florida wins 47.4% of faceoffs, 27th-ranked in the NHL.
  • The Panthers' 10.5% shooting percentage is 22nd in the league.
